Wiktionary

  1. bang on(Verb)

    To constantly talk about

  2. bang on(Adjective)

    Precisely accurate; exactly appropriate or fitting.

  3. bang on(Preposition)

    Exactly at

The New Hacker's Dictionary

  1. bang on

    To stress-test a piece of hardware or software: “I banged on the new version of the simulator all day yesterday and it didn't crash once. I guess it is ready for release.” The term pound on is synonymous.
